    Quote Originally Posted by Platinumstorm View Post
    Guess you could always give the option to cap versus not - then both types of players are satisfied.
    However, you then get the group of players that are always: "Why should we cap it when we can blow through straight to the boss uncapped?"

    Look at what happened with Assault in FFXI, you had the option to cap it at 50,60,70, or 75, no one ever capped it and left it at uncapped. "Both sides" won't be happy because those who would want to have it capped with be guaranteed to always end up in a party with at least 90% who want it uncapped.
